senploy is seeking compassionate Maths and English Tutors in North Shields to support students who have been permanently excluded from mainstream education. The role involves delivering personalized tutoring sessions, developing lesson plans, and helping students overcome emotional and social barriers to learning.

Candidates should have experience with SEND and hold an enhanced DBS certificate. The position offers flexible hours, with pay rates up to £30 per hour. Start date is September 2025.
